I Sharifpour is a scholar working on Aquatic Science, Immunology and Ecology. According to data from OpenAlex, I Sharifpour has authored 54 papers receiving a total of 388 ind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Aquatic Science, 24 papers in Immunology and 12 papers in Ecology. Recurrent topics in I Sharifpour's work include Aquaculture disease management and microbiota (24 papers), Aquaculture Nutrition and Growth (17 papers) and Fish Biology and Ecology Studies (13 papers). I Sharifpour is often cited by papers focused on Aquaculture disease management and microbiota (24 papers), Aquaculture Nutrition and Growth (17 papers) and Fish Biology and Ecology Studies (13 papers). I Sharifpour collaborates with scholars based in Iran, Canada and Malaysia. I Sharifpour's co-authors include Mehdi Soltani, H A Ebrahimzadeh Mousavi, S Kakoolaki, Seyed Saeed Mirzargar, Shahla Jamili, A. A. Motalebi, H Khara, Mohammad Reza Kalbassi, Mohammad Reza Imanpoor and Pargol Ghavam Mostafavi and has published in prestigious journals such as SHILAP Revista de lepidopterología, Marine Pollution Bulletin and Ecotoxicology and Environmental Safety.
